BUTTER CHAMPIONSHIP.

ALTERATION TO RULE. FACTORY MANAGERS’ VIEW. Proposals for a change in the rule governing entries for the iS\ ipetit ion tor the butter championship of New Zealand were advanced at the annual meeting, last evening, of the New Zealand Dairy Factory Managers’ Association, by Mr W. S. Death (Awahuri). Mr Death said he wished to object to the rule governing the championship class for butter as sot down for the National Dairy Show. He pointed out that the rule stipulated that any butter-maker who had won the championship twice in succession or three times at intervals was debarred from taking further- part in the annual competitions. That prevented him from ever winning the championship for his company again, hut what if he changed to another factory? He was barred also from winning thee liampionship for that company. The competition should he an open one. It was hold “under t he auspices of the New Zealand Dairy Factory Managers’ Association.” Therefore it was for the association to say if the rule should be altered. The speaker moved that the competition be an open one.

The motion was carried, without dissent.
